What Ilaria Means

Italian name meaning "cheerful" or "joyful." It is derived from the Latin 'hilaris'.

Ilaria is a name that blooms from the Latin word 'hilaris,' meaning 'cheerful' and 'joyful.' It was a popular name among the ancient Romans, associated with mirth and lightheartedness. From its Roman origins, the name traveled through Italy, becoming a beloved choice in its melodic, Italian form. It has maintained its association with happiness throughout centuries, finding renewed popularity across continents.
